Jeanne talks with Sarah Bowen Shea, author of the three books about running and motherhood and founder of the online running community - Another Mother Runner, about why exercise is essential for moms before, during and after pregnancy.Learn more about your ad choices. Visit megaphone.fm/adchoices

Pregnancy, Parenting & Politics, is a breath of fresh air: accessible, authoritative, funny, reassuring and personal. It's chock-full of Jeanne's comprehensive, medically-sound advice and insights plus conversations with women, mothers and experts in pregnancy, parenting and the power to change the world. Women's health expert, labor nurse, feminist, mother of four, Fit Pregnancy.com columnist and author of Common Sense Pregnancy (Random House, 2015), Jeanne Faulkner has been at the bedside for thousands of deliveries. She provides the honest insider advice you need during pregnancy, labor, birth, and parenthood. Jeanne believes that parents have the power to change the world and that's what we're talking about here on Pregnancy, Parenting & Politics.
